Gemma Guerrero, a seasoned entrepreneur with over 30 years in international business, shared her journey from tutoring classmates in college to leading sales at Chemex International, where she secured 10 accounts in Southeast Asia. She discussed her transition to the bottled water industry, growing a company from a small team to a 16-person operation, and her involvement in VR and AR technology. Gemma emphasized the importance of leadership, consensus-building, and understanding cultural nuances. She highlighted the challenges of funding and corruption in the Philippines, advocating for ethical AI use and the need for educated leadership. Gemma is now focusing on consulting and supporting women entrepreneurs.

Episode Highlights
Gemma Guerrero's Journey and Early Influences
- Daryl Urbanski introduces Gemma Guerrero, highlighting her extensive experience in international business and market development.
- Gemma shares her origin story, mentioning her father's transition from a corporate job to starting his own advertising company.
- Gemma discusses her early entrepreneurial ventures in college, including tutoring classmates for money and working for a financial insurance company.
- Gemma recounts her first professional role at Chemex International, where she started as a secretary and eventually became a sales account executive.
First Entrepreneurial Ventures and Successes
- Gemma Guerrero describes her initial role at Chemex International, trading plastic resin from countries like Mexico and Saudi Arabia.
- She shares her determination to prove herself in the company, leading to a 10-day trip to Southeast Asia where she secured 10 new accounts.
- Gemma Guerrero discusses the cultural challenges she faced as a young woman in a male-dominated industry and how she overcame them.
- She highlights the importance of timing and luck in her early successes, including her involvement in the bottled water industry.
Transition to Technology and Marriage
- Gemma Guerrero talks about her transition to the technology industry, working with her husband on VR and AR projects.
- She shares the challenges and lessons learned from their venture into technology, including competition from tech giants like Google and Facebook.
- Gemma discusses her marriage to a Lebanese businessman and how it led to her involvement in the water business in Lebanon.
- She reflects on the importance of timing and the role of luck in her career, including the impact of COVID-19 on their business plans.
